Both acetaldehyde and acetone (individually) undergo which of the following reactions?
A. Iodoform Reaction
B. Cannizzaro Reaction
C. Aldol Condensation
D. Tollen's Test
E. Clemmensen Reduction
Choose the correct answer from the options given below
A, C and E Only
Cannizzaro Reaction:
- Cannizzaro reaction occurs in aldoses (aldehydes with no \(\alpha\)-hydrogen).
- Acetaldehyde \(\left(C{H}_{3}CHO\right)\) has an \(\alpha\)-hydrogen, so it does NOT undergo the Cannizzaro reaction.
- Acetone \(\left(C{H}_{3}COC{H}_{3}\right)\) is a ketone and also does not undergo the Cannizzaro reaction.
Tollen's Test:
- Tollen's test detects aldehydes (it oxidizes them to carboxylic acids).
- Acetaldehyde \(\left(C{H}_{3}CHO\right)\) is an aldehyde, so it gives a positive Tollen's test.
- Acetone \(\left(C{H}_{3}COC{H}_{3}\right)\) is a ketone, and ketones do not give Tollen's test.
